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/linux/27.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/html/80.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Linux 无头HTML5地理定位_Linux_Html_Geolocation - Fatal编程技术网

Linux 无头HTML5地理定位

Linux 无头HTML5地理定位,linux,html,geolocation,Linux,Html,Geolocation,我想知道是否有任何方法可以在基于Debian的系统上获得HTML5地理定位系统而无需GUI 我的计划是通过HTML5定位一台没有GPS系统的计算机,所以我想我会用无头浏览器向我的web服务器发送一个请求,获取无头浏览器的位置(以某种方式接受提示),然后返回给我的服务器,我错了吗 我看过phantomjs,但显然它不适用于地理定位 (是的,我已经看到了这一点,但我认为答案已经过时,我的问题更准确) 谢谢如果浏览器没有GPS,那么它只会使用GeoIP服务。为什么要麻烦使用浏览器作为中间人呢?只需自己

我想知道是否有任何方法可以在基于Debian的系统上获得HTML5地理定位系统而无需GUI

我的计划是通过HTML5定位一台没有GPS系统的计算机,所以我想我会用无头浏览器向我的web服务器发送一个请求,获取无头浏览器的位置(以某种方式接受提示),然后返回给我的服务器,我错了吗

我看过phantomjs,但显然它不适用于地理定位

(是的,我已经看到了这一点,但我认为答案已经过时,我的问题更准确)


谢谢

如果浏览器没有GPS,那么它只会使用GeoIP服务。为什么要麻烦使用浏览器作为中间人呢?只需自己对其进行GeoIP。因为GeoIP根本不准确,只需尝试比较HTML5地理定位和IP地理定位,您就会看到差异。差异(可能是由于不同的数据库)当我在我现在的位置上测试它时,步行大约5分钟。我从来没有达到过5分钟,即使我已经达到了5分钟,它也不足以满足我的需要。